Output 058494174e4d63c2d65d02c2cb4da0da5ff0ee0683a423ac19d4e82a1aa10742:30

value
166000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 284031f8a812b4ad11c148b98be9219ffed19806 OP_EQUAL
address
35MqraTcWRv2fYYg3MH6n6NNENHTnHf89b
transaction
058494174e4d63c2d65d02c2cb4da0da5ff0ee0683a423ac19d4e82a1aa10742
spent
true